Cynthia Stein, MD, MPH, MMSc is an Assistant Professor of Orthopedic Surgery at Harvard Medical School and serves as an Attending Physician in the Orthopedics and Sports Medicine Department at Boston Children's Hospital. She holds leadership positions as Director of the Medical Sports Medicine Fellowship and Co-Team Physician for Emmanuel College.
Dr. Stein completed her medical education at the University of California, Los Angeles in 1997, followed by an Internal Medicine residency at UCLA Center for Health Sciences in 2000, and a Sports Medicine fellowship at Boston Children's Hospital. Her diverse credentials (MD, MPH, MMSc) reflect her comprehensive training in clinical medicine, public health, and medical sciences.
Her research interests span multiple areas within sports medicine, with particular focus on pediatric and adolescent sports injuries, concussion management, dance medicine, and medical education. Dr. Stein has made significant contributions to understanding sport-specific injury patterns, particularly in fencing athletes, lumbar spine injuries in young athletes, and hallux sesamoid injuries. Her work also addresses important gender-specific considerations in sports medicine, including menstrual patterns in dancers and gender norms related to concussion reporting.
Analysis of Dr. Stein's publication record reveals consistent focus on practical clinical applications in sports medicine, with emphasis on both injury prevention and treatment strategies. Her work bridges clinical practice with academic research, particularly evident in her studies on medical education and the impact of the pandemic on sports medicine fellowship training.
As Director of the Medical Sports Medicine Fellowship, Dr. Stein plays a key role in training the next generation of sports medicine specialists. Her leadership extends to her role as Co-Team Physician for Emmanuel College, where she provides direct care to collegiate athletes and contributes to the Sports Medicine Division's mission of providing 'real-time injury evaluation and support for more than 30 school and college teams throughout New England.'
